Home electrification is good for your wallet

Going green is not only good for the climate, it can also be good for your wallet. But there are costs associated with switching to electric cars and heat pumps.

In 2024, the annual savings will be over DKK 14,000 for households that have both replaced their petrol car with an electric car and scrapped their gas boiler in favour of a heat pump. This is shown by new figures from the industry organisation Green Power Denmark.

The annual energy bill in 2024 for electrified households is DKK 8,851. And that is DKK 14,426 lower than the amount that owners of petrol cars and natural gas boilers have to pay.

The calculation example is based on an electric car that drives 4.6 kilometres per kilowatt-hour and a petrol car that drives 15 kilometres per litre. The driving requirement for both types of car is around 10,000 kilometres. The annual heating requirement in the home is set at 13.2 megawatt-hours. However, the calculations do not include the costs of purchasing an electric car and a heat pump.

- A new electric car is a major investment for most people. And a new air-to-water heat pump can cost up to DKK 100,000 more than a new gas boiler, says Martin Ingerslev, chief economist at Green Power Denmark.

There are different types of heat pumps. An air-to-water heat pump converts the heat energy in the air outside into room heat.

Sales of heat pumps have fallen in recent years. This may be due to uncertainty about where and when district heating will be rolled out, and a lack of an end date for the gas network, Green Power Denmark estimates.

- It is important that there are financial incentives that can support citizens' green choices, says Martin Ingerslev.

On the other hand, electric car sales are still going strong, which according to Green Power Denmark is being helped by the fact that taxes are set to be significantly reduced from 2026.

Home charging is cheapest

The car owners' interest organization, FDM, has also made calculations on what it will cost to drive an electric car compared to a comparable petrol car.

- If we look exclusively at the costs of charging and petrol, electric car owners can save up to DKK 1,000 per month, says consumer economist at FDM Ilyas Dogru, but points out that the calculation is based on a driving need of 20,000 kilometers per year.

He adds that the savings will be greatest for electric car owners who have the opportunity to charge their electric car at home with their own charging box.

- And if you make sure to chase the cheap electricity prices, the savings can be even greater than 1000 DKK per month, says Ilyas Dogru.

- That is one of the advantages of the electric car - that you can wait to charge until the electricity is cheapest.

If it is not possible to charge at home, the financial gain will be smaller, because the price of public charging stations is typically higher.
